ROASTINGTECHNIQUES
Roastingisveryeasy withyourKenmore Elite gas
grill.It leaves youplentyof time to relax withfamily
and friends and savesyou the hoursrequiredtoclean
a dirtykitchenoven. Roastingissuitablefor prime,
tendercutsof meat, poultryand game, manywhole
fishand somevegetables.
Preparing to Roast
Roastingusesthe indirect cooking method.
Therefore, thefood shouldbeplacedonthe lel_or
right side ofyour grillwiththe burnerlitonthe oppo-
siteside. Place your meat insidean optionalmasting
reckand cookingpan that allowsyou to collectjuices
for makinggravy.You canalso usethe supplied
cookinggridwithan aluminumdrippanunderneath.
Eitherway, indirectcookingrequiresthe lidofyour
grillto be closed.
Preheatingyourgdllisnotrequiredfor slowcooking
methods suchas masting. Ifyou do chooseto
preheatyour grillbeforemasting, turnthe burnerson
highand close lidfor approximately2-3 minutes.
Food preparation
Trim meat ofexcessfat. Truss meat and poultrywith
cooking stringto retainshape ifdesired. Baconstdps
canbe usedtocover the outsidesurfaceoflean meat
and poultrytohelppreventitfrom dryingout.Another
methodfor keepingfoodmoistduringroastingisto put
water in a cooking pan,then coverthefood(and
roastingrack) withfoil. The foil shouldbe removedfor
the firstor the lastpartof the cooking time to ensure
properbrowning.
Tips for masting
Except when mastingwith waterin the roastingpan,
the juices that collect in the pan can be used as the
basefor a tastysauce orgravy. Placea cooking pan
directlyover the heat, add extrabutterifneeded, then
add severalspoonfulsofflourtothickensauce. Finally,
add sufficientchickenor beef stocktoobtain the
desired consistency.
Once the meat iscooked,remove itfromyourgrill and
cover with a pieceoffoil. Allowitto stand for 10-15
minuteswhichallowsthejuices tosettle. Thiswill
make carvingeasier and ensurea tenderjuicyroast.
